If you want to run the last working version of YouTube you can install Aptoid TV.
You will need to side load it with ES file explorer and have the unknown sources enabled in settings.
Once you have aptoid you can search for YouTube TV and then choose other versions. Go back about 3 versions to the one released in December 2017 and you should be good.
In google play disable auto updates. Been working great for me so far.

The first units (A06 & A07) had the AirMouse with the little 2.4Ghz dongles. However, when Google did their certification, they didn't allow the AirMouse which meant subsequent units (A11 & A12) has the IR remote.
